WordPress Database Optimization for Newbies

Optimisation de base de données WordPress pour les débutants

Qu'est-ce que la base de données WordPress ? À quoi ça sert?

Toutes les données d'un site Web sont conservées dans une base de données. Tout le contenu des pages et des publications, les informations sur les thèmes et les plugins, ainsi que plusieurs autres paramètres, choix et données relationnelles sont tous inclus ici. Tout site Web qui existe depuis un certain temps a probablement développé une surcharge de base de données au fil du temps.

L'encombrement de la base de données peut nuire aux performances d'un site Web et à toutes les activités backend en plus d'utiliser de l'espace de stockage inutile. Par conséquent, supprimer toutes les données superflues de votre base de données WordPress pourrait rendre votre site Web plus efficace. Cet article couvrira toutes les méthodes par lesquelles votre base de données peut obtenir des données supplémentaires et comment les optimiser de manière appropriée.

Avant de commencer, il est important de noter que vous devez toujours sauvegarder votre base de données WordPress avant d’apporter des modifications. Cela garantira que vous pourrez revenir à une version précédente en cas de problème.

Pour sauvegarder votre base de données WordPress, vous pouvez utiliser un plugin comme BackupBuddy ou WP Database Backup. Alternativement, vous pouvez sauvegarder manuellement votre base de données via phpMyAdmin.

Une fois que vous avez sauvegardé votre base de données, vous êtes prêt à commencer à l'optimiser.

Optimisation de la base de données WordPress : Pourquoi devez-vous faire cela ?


Les avantages de l’optimisation de votre base de données WordPress sont nombreux. Les plus évidents sont l'amélioration des performances de votre site Web et le fonctionnement plus efficace de votre serveur. En conséquence, les visiteurs de votre site Web trouveront plus facile de parcourir votre contenu, ce qui pourrait entraîner une amélioration des taux d’engagement et de conversion.

De plus, il y a d’autres avantages à prendre en compte. Les utilisateurs disposant d'un stockage limité sur leurs plans d'hébergement doivent disposer d'une base de données efficace. De plus, vous devez optimiser votre base de données si vous avez l'intention dedéplacer votre site Web vers un nouveau serveur , car certains plugins de migration ont des restrictions de stockage sur le volume de données pouvant être déplacées.

Nous allons maintenant passer rapidement en revue toutes les façons dont l'encombrement de la base de données peut s'accumuler sur votre site Web afin de mieux comprendre ce qui doit être supprimé. Cela inclut les révisions de publication inutilisées, les publications rédigées automatiquement et les publications que vous avez supprimées inutilement, le spam, les commentaires supprimés et refusés, les transitoires, les pingbacks et les rétroliens obsolètes, les tables de base de données restantes ou inefficaces et les données inutilisées. Ci-dessous, nous fournirons une description rapide de chacun d’entre eux.

Les révisions des articles ont été apportées pour la première fois dans la mise à niveau de WordPress 2.6. Ils remplacent les itérations antérieures de vos articles et brouillons révisés, sur lesquels vous pouvez revenir. Cependant, comme toutes ces informations sont conservées dans votre base de données, elles pourraient bientôt s’accumuler. Par conséquent, limiter le nombre de modifications stockées dans la base de données ou les éliminer complètement peut aider à minimiser sa taille.

La base de données peut s'encombrer considérablement en raison d'éléments jetés à la poubelle. Ces objets resteront à la poubelle pendant 30 jours avant d'être définitivement éliminés s'ils ne sont pas restaurés. Par conséquent, si vous gérez un site Web très fréquenté, vos déchets peuvent déborder d'objets, ce qui rend difficile leur suppression simultanée et permanente.

Si votre site Web autorise les commentaires, vous avez probablement eu du mal à supprimer le spam provenant à la fois des personnes humaines et, le plus souvent, des robots automatisés. Heureusement, WordPress vous propose quelques outils pour résoudre partiellement ce problème. Pour éviter qu'une remarque ne soit vue par les visiteurs du site Web, vous pouvez la refuser, la supprimer ou la désigner comme spam. Néanmoins, ces remarques continueront d’être conservées dans la base de données, augmentant ainsi l’encombrement déjà excessif de la base de données. Vous avez la possibilité de le faire, ce qui réduira considérablement la surcharge de la base de données.

Les transitoires permettent aux développeurs WordPress de sauvegarder des données ayant une date d'expiration plutôt que d'avoir à les charger à chaque chargement d'une page, ce qui ralentirait votre site Web. À cet égard, ils fonctionnent de manière similaire au cache du navigateur. Cependant, si vous testez une fonctionnalité, par exemple, vous devez supprimer les transitoires une fois qu'ils expirent afin d'éliminer ces données superflues de votre base de données et d'observer le résultat réel sur votre site Web.

L’utilisation des pingbacks et des rétroliens, une fonction de WordPress, a largement diminué au fil du temps. Si vous les utilisez, éliminer ceux de votre base de données aidera votre base de données WordPress à fonctionner plus efficacement et à réduire le gonflement. Vérifiez la page que nous avons liée ci-dessus si vous souhaitez en savoir plus sur les pingbacks et les rétroliens ou si vous ne savez pas ce qu'ils sont. Vous pouvez choisir de les utiliser dans un premier temps après avoir été informé de tous les avantages et inconvénients.

Optimisation de la base de données WordPress avec des plugins

Certains plugins pourraient étendre les tables existantes de votre base de données et y ajouter des données utiles. Cependant, ces tables supplémentaires risquent de ne pas être supprimées si vous désactivez et supprimez ces plugins . Votre site Web risque d’en être affecté et de devenir plus lent qu’il ne devrait l’être. Par conséquent, il est essentiel d’optimiser périodiquement votre base de données en supprimant les tables résiduelles inutilisées. Le simple fait de supprimer quoi que ce soit d'une table peut laisser des données orphelines puisque MySQL dépend des relations entre les données. Il s'agit d'informations liées à tout ce que vous avez effacé, par exemple étant empêtrées dans les tables de la base de données du plugin. Pour réduire votre base de données et améliorer son efficacité, vous devez supprimer toutes les données orphelines. Les métadonnées sur les publications, commentaires et relations orphelins sont incluses ici.

De plus, vous pouvez restructurer les données actuelles de manière à ce qu'elles utilisent moins d'espace de stockage et soient plus faciles à récupérer. Ceci est accompli en utilisant l'option Optimiser la table de phpMyAdmin ou une option de plugin comparable qui en dépend.

Un petit récapitulatif : Pourquoi optimiser la base de données WordPress ?

Il y a plusieurs raisons pour lesquelles il est important d’optimiser votre base de données WordPress :

  1. Premièrement, à mesure que votre site se développe, votre base de données deviendra de plus en plus saturée de données inutiles. Cela peut entraîner une diminution des performances et même des erreurs de base de données.
  2. Deuxièmement, si jamais vous avez besoin de restaurer votre site à partir d'une sauvegarde, vous devez vous assurer que votre base de données est aussi propre et simple que possible. Une base de données surchargée peut rendre votre processus de restauration plus long que nécessaire et peut même entraîner des erreurs.
  3. Troisièmement, l'optimisation de votre base de données peut contribuer à améliorer la sécurité de votre site. Un site WordPress qui n'est pas régulièrement optimisé est plus sensible aux attaques par injection SQL.
  4. Quatrièmement, l'optimisation de votre base de données peut vous aider à résoudre les problèmes sur votre site. Si vous rencontrez un problème avec votre site, une bonne première étape consiste à vérifier votre base de données pour détecter les erreurs.

Enfin, optimiser votre base de données n’est qu’une bonne pratique. Comme tout autre type de base de données, une base de données WordPress doit être régulièrement optimisée pour assurer son bon fonctionnement.

Comment optimiser votre base de données WordPress et obtenir une amélioration des performances


Maintenant que vous savez pourquoi il est important d'optimiser votre base de données WordPress, examinons quelques-uns des meilleurs plugins pour ce travail. Nous vous conseillons fortement de créer une sauvegarde de base de données à l'avance, car jouer avec la base de données pourrait potentiellement endommager votre site Web. Des sauvegardes régulières des bases de données et des sites Web sont généralement une bonne idée. Alors avec ça, commençons.

Utiliser un plugin pour l'optimisation WordPress

Il existe de nombreux plugins WordPress disponibles, ce qui permet d'en choisir facilement un qui répond à pratiquement tous les besoins. Vous pouvez soit rechercher des plugins spécialement conçus pour l’optimisation des bases de données, soit ceux conçus pour augmenter l’efficacité de votre site Web dans son ensemble lorsqu’il s’agit d’optimiser votre base de données WordPress.

WP-Optimiser

WP-Optimize est un plugin populaire qui vous aide à nettoyer votre base de données WordPress. Il peut supprimer les données inutiles, telles que les publications supprimées, les révisions et les commentaires indésirables. Il vous aide également à optimiser vos tables de base de données.

Télécharger

Gestionnaire WP-DB

WP-DB Manager est un excellent plugin pour optimiser votre base de données WordPress. Il vous permet d'exécuter des requêtes de base de données et de réparer les tables de base de données. Il vous aide également à sauvegarder votre base de données et fournit un certain nombre d'autres fonctionnalités.

Télécharger

Nettoyeur de base de données avancé

Advanced Database Cleaner est un autre excellent plugin pour optimiser votre base de données WordPress. Il vous aide à nettoyer votre base de données en supprimant les données inutiles. Il vous permet également d'optimiser les tables de votre base de données et de réparer les tables corrompues.

Télécharger

Comment optimiser la base de données WordPress

Maintenant que vous savez pourquoi il est important d'optimiser votre base de données WordPress et que vous avez vu certains des meilleurs plugins pour ce travail, passons en revue le processus d'utilisation d'un plugin pour optimiser votre base de données.

Pour les besoins de ce tutoriel, nous utiliserons le plugin WP-Optimize. Cependant, le processus est similaire pour les autres plugins.

Tout d’abord, vous devrez installer et activer le plugin WP-Optimize. Pour plus d’informations, consultez notre guide sur la façon d’installer un plugin WordPress.

Une fois le plugin activé, vous devrez visiter la page WP-Optimize dans votre zone d'administration WordPress. Vous devriez voir une liste d'options, ainsi qu'un bouton indiquant « Démarrer le nettoyage ».

Avant de commencer le nettoyage, nous vous recommandons de sauvegarder votre base de données. De cette façon, en cas de problème, vous pourrez restaurer votre base de données à partir de la sauvegarde.

Pour sauvegarder votre base de données, faites défiler jusqu'à la section « Options de base de données » et cliquez sur le bouton « Sauvegarder la base de données ».

Maintenant que vous avez sauvegardé votre base de données, vous êtes prêt à commencer le nettoyage. Revenez en haut de la page et cliquez sur le bouton « Démarrer le nettoyage ».

WP-Optimize va maintenant analyser votre base de données et supprimer toutes les données inutiles. Une fois l'opération terminée, vous verrez un message indiquant « La base de données a été nettoyée avec succès ».

Et c'est tout! Vous avez optimisé avec succès votre base de données WordPress à l'aide du plugin WP-Optimize.

Si vous souhaitez en savoir plus sur WP-Optimize, nous vous recommandons de consulter la documentation du plugin.


Conclusion

Nous espérons que cet article vous a aidé à apprendre à optimiser la base de données WordPress avec un plugin. N'oubliez pas qu'il est important de garder votre base de données propre et simple pour les performances, la sécurité et le dépannage.

Si vous recherchez d’autres moyens d’accélérer votre site, nous vous recommandons de consulter notre guide sur la façon d’accélérer WordPress.

Et si vous souhaitez en savoir plus sur les bases de données WordPress en général, nous vous recommandons de consulter notre didacticiel sur les bases de données WordPress.